Transaction 561f133882316c391d632062398622a4eef76ea4cf0a55d4a2c65756617f02ca
1 Input
1 Output
-
561f133882316c391d632062398622a4eef76ea4cf0a55d4a2c65756617f02ca:0
- value
- 4052704
- script pubkey
- OP_0 OP_PUSHBYTES_20 525123d54f6932a8f1d878183eafed1d23dae998
- address
- bc1q2fgj8420dye23uwc0qvratldr53a46vcja23ya